Breaking NFL Update: Key Player Resigns Ahead of 2023 Season

In a significant move, the Kansas City Chiefs have confirmed the re-signing of Pro Bowl defensive end Chris Jones. This decision impacts the team as they prepare for the upcoming season and underscores their commitment to maintaining a competitive roster.

What Was Announced

The Kansas City Chiefs made headlines by announcing that Chris Jones has officially signed a four-year contract extension worth $80 million, making him one of the highest-paid defensive ends in the league. This news comes just days before the start of training camp, a critical period for teams to finalize their rosters and strategies.

Jones’ previous contract was set to expire after this season, making the urgency to secure him even more pressing for the Chiefs. As a key defensive player who contributed significantly to the team’s recent Super Bowl victory, his return is crucial for Kansas City.

Player or Team Context

Chris Jones has been a cornerstone of the Chiefs’ defense since being drafted in 2016. His exceptional skills have not only earned him multiple Pro Bowl selections but also recognition as a formidable force against opposing offenses. The Chiefs’ front office emphasized their confidence in Jones, highlighting his leadership qualities and experience as vital assets for the upcoming season.

The decision to secure Jones for four more years reflects the Chiefs’ long-term planning and recognition of his impact on team culture and performance.
